Trees and hedges have grown to form a visual barrier at the front of the houses, impeding the opportunity for natural surveillance and creating a potential hiding places.
CloseTrees and hedges have grown to form a visual barrier at the front of the houses, impeding the opportunity for natural surveillance and creating a potential hiding places.